Output 3b68f12fe32de92bc907fbf45dc582d996e95c3a6dc50c81735aaa192c31e440:21

value
2327669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 391f3eb873568b9904daccbbc06cd763507993a9 OP_EQUAL
address
36u3sRFPCc83dvAQtkecBePPo9HCRaqJXG
transaction
3b68f12fe32de92bc907fbf45dc582d996e95c3a6dc50c81735aaa192c31e440
spent
true